Education in the USA

In the USA, children start elementary school when they are five or six years old. It lasts six years. The first year at elementary school is called kindergarten. Schooling is compulsory in the USA until the students are 16 or 18 years old, which depends on the state. People don't have to pay tuition fees at schools in the USA.

After elementary school, youngsters attend secondary school, which lasts three years. The curriculum there includes such subjects as English, Maths, Biology, Physical Education, History and some others. Besides, the schools offer elective subjects which students can choose to attend.

To celebrate finishing school, students have a prom where they can choose the queen and the king of the evening.
